
==Mission description== QuikSCAT was launched on 19 June 1999 with an initial 3-year mission requirement. QuikSCAT was a `quick recovery` mission replacing the NASA Scatterometer (NSCAT), which failed prematurely in June 1997 after just 9.5 months in operation.
